Minister Baryomunsi faints in Kanungu, airlifted to Kampala

Dr. Chris Baryomunsi, Minister of ICT and National Guidance, was airlifted to Kampala last evening after collapsing in Kanungu.

Baryomunsi was first rushed to Kambuga Hospital in Kanungu, but there were reportedly no medical supplies.

Dr. Baryomunsi, who doubles as Kinkiizi East Member of Parliament, is said to have fainted at around 6 p.m. while on his way from Ruhija in Muramba Parish, Rutenga Sub County. where he donated iron sheets to the Church of Uganda’s Kyakikyere church, according to Godfrey Karabenda, the Kanungu District National Resistance Movement (NRM) party chairman.

Through his official social media handle, the minister said,

“Friends, yesterday I had a blackout while in my constituency. I was moving from one church function to another. I was rushed to Kambuga Hospital and then airlifted to Mulago Hospital. I am now stable and out of danger. The medical team is carrying out further tests. “There’s no need to worry.”
